关于债券到期收益率的问题,求教!!!

有两种1000美元的债权,一种为20年期,售价为800美元,当期收益率为15%;还有一种期限为一年,售价也是800美元,当期收益率为5%,哪一种债券的到期收益率高呢?

题目有点模糊 没说清楚债券付息的类型
当期收益率=年利息/购买价格
到期收益率可以理解为贴现率
假定20年的是累息债券 是到期一次换本付息的 (付息债券的话 计算很麻烦 每年的利息都要贴现一次 参考付息债券理论价格的计算)
800*15%=120 这个是用当期收益率和买入价格算出年利息
120*20=2400 这个是20年的利息
2400+1000=3400 这个是到期还本付息
3400/(1+y)^20=800 ^20 是20次方 现值800 终值3400 期限20年 y就是到期收益率
y=7.5%
第二种债券
800*5%=40 和第一个一样 算出一年的利息
40+1000=1040 这个是一年后到手的钱
1040/(1+y1)=800 1040是终值 800是现值 期限一年 求得到期收益率y1=30%
y1>y 第二种的到期收益率高
温馨提示:内容为网友见解,仅供参考
第1个回答  2011-11-24
到期收益当然是20年期的高了,不过时间也长,20年啊。
相似回答